Superior Corrosion Resistance for Demanding Fluids

The primary advantage of stainless steel multistage pumps in industrial settings is their exceptional resistance to corrosion. Unlike cast iron or carbon steel pumps, which are susceptible to rust and degradation when handling aggressive media, pumps constructed from stainless steel, such as those manufactured by Shanghai Gaotian Pump, offer remarkable longevity. This makes them ideally suited for a wide range of challenging applications, including handling mildly corrosive chemicals, seawater, saline solutions, and potable water where water purity is paramount. The inert nature of stainless steel ensures that the pumped fluid remains uncontaminated, which is a critical requirement in the food and beverage, pharmaceutical, and chemical processing industries. Gaotian's expertise in precision casting of stainless steel components guarantees that their pumps can withstand the harsh internal environment of constant fluid flow, significantly reducing the frequency of maintenance and replacement parts, and leading to a lower total cost of ownership over the pump's lifecycle.

High-Pressure Capability and Space-Efficient Design

Multistage pumps are engineered to generate high discharge pressures by housing multiple impellers in series within a single casing. As fluid passes through each stage, the pressure is incrementally increased, allowing these pumps to achieve pressures that would be impractical for single-stage pumps of a comparable size. This characteristic is indispensable for applications like high-rise building water supply, boiler feed systems, industrial pressure washing, and reverse osmosis (RO) systems. Furthermore, the multistage design is inherently compact. Shanghai Gaotian Pump's vertical multistage models, for instance, feature a space-saving vertical in-line configuration that minimizes their footprint, a significant benefit in space-constrained plant rooms or equipment skids. This combination of high-pressure output and a small installation area provides engineers with a highly efficient and versatile solution for complex industrial system requirements.

Enhanced Durability, Efficiency, and Reliability

The combination of robust stainless steel construction and a precision-engineered multistage hydraulic system results in a pump renowned for its durability and operational efficiency. The mechanical strength of stainless steel allows these pumps to withstand higher system pressures and potential water hammer effects with greater resilience. The balanced impellers and shafts minimize vibration and noise, leading to smoother operation and reduced wear on bearings and seals. For a manufacturer like Gaotian, whose products must pass stringent ISO 9001 quality checks, this translates into exceptional reliability. This reliability ensures minimal unplanned downtime, which is critical for continuous industrial processes. Moreover, the hydraulically optimized design of modern multistage pumps ensures that energy is used effectively to generate pressure, reducing electricity consumption and contributing to lower operational costs and a smaller environmental footprint over the long term.
